Understanding Door Hinges

Before diving deep into the occupation, it's important to understand what door hinges are and their importance. A hinge is a mechanical gadget that connects two items, permitting rotation, usually around a vertical axis. The main function of a door hinge is to allow a door to swing open and closed efficiently.

Types of Hinges

Different kinds of door hinges are offered, each fit for different applications. Here's a brief overview of the most common types:

Type of HingeDescriptionTypical Uses
Butt HingeThe most common type, generally set up on doors.Residential and commercial doors.
Continuous HingeA long hinge that runs along the entire height of the door.Heavy-duty applications, like commercial doors.
Piano HingeA type of continuous hinge, normally longer and utilized for folding doors.Pianos, cabinets, and folding furniture.
Hidden HingeHidden from view when the door is closed.Cabinets and contemporary furniture.
Spring HingeEnables doors to self-close.Screen doors and interior doors.
Pivot HingeEnables the door to turn from a single point at the top and bottom.Heavy commercial doors.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How do I know if my door hinge requires to be changed?

Indications include extreme squeaking, misalignment, rust, or if the door fails to stay open.

2. Can I set up door hinges myself?

While it's possible, incorrect installation can lead to functionality problems. Working with a professional is advised for the very best outcomes.

3. What kind of hinge is best for outside doors?

Butt hinges are typically chosen for outside doors due to their strength and flexibility.

4. How typically should door hinges be preserved?

Regular maintenance is recommended at least once a year, with more regular checks in high-traffic areas.
